The First Ever AI-Generated Screamer is an AI-generated YouTube Shorts screamer uploaded by Lorenzo Yario (Lawiki) for his lawhichcraft returns YouTube channel on December 14th, 2024.

The video starts with a rather unassuming lake, along with some trees in the background. Water and ducks can be heard as well. At the four second mark, the video suddenly cuts to footage of a man with bloodshot eyes, pale white skin, and his mouth open screaming loudly. At the seven second mark, the cuts to another video of a man with devilish outfit screaming. This man later jumps out of his suit and screams at the viewer a second time.

Now that you are ready, let's start contributing! To write anything, you must make a new page. To do this you must search for the page in the search bar; if the page does not exist, there will be a prompt allowing you to create the page. Give the page the same name as the screamer, for example ScaryScreamer.com. You are now ready to write your page!

You can help Screamer Wiki too by saving already existing screamers, shock sites, and videos to the Web Archive (https://archive.org/web/). If a screamer or shock site gets deleted, banned or removed, then there is a chance that we can retrieve it using the Wayback Machine.
